Subject: some crop pics from E.C. Mn.


ecmn

snapped a couple pics today.  the first pic is of pioneer P8906hr at 38k population planted may 3rd.  My first time with this hybrid and we will see how it yeilds. but this plant from day one never did stop growing, other corn planted on the same day at different populations was up to 2 growth stages behind at 3rd week june.
3rd week of june i top dressed and foliar feed all the corn.  july 1st this plant was knee high, on the 5th this plant was between chest and waist high, on the 12 it was over my head slightly and today its clearly taller then me,  i am 6'5" tall for a reference.
all the other corn is shorter, most of it is about a foot shorter then this corn or just over my head by a few inches.
the beans are good old 90m80's.  not to far from having the rows canapied over.  

like the rest of the state we had a tough cold wet spring/summer.  but its nice to see driving around the local area that all of the yellow corn is gone and the corn is starting to shoot up. heck everyday there is a few more tassles around the block! saw the uncles/cousins corn north of me had a nice field all tassled out, that one had to be the first field around that was mostly tassled.   


You know its just really nice to see everyones crops kicking in and really looking good in the area! we might make a normal harvest yet??!!!
